Output 23da87d7558d700efc0539cb003a676935baa33f13a7ed76d8c595024a709e09:1

value
149136750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d9ba51b3e6919b3c2d0043e56378ad740021f08 OP_EQUALVERIFY OP_CHECKSIG
address
LPP78FDQvstwrUm3x4mZFHkpaUqX1TW3Fa
transaction
23da87d7558d700efc0539cb003a676935baa33f13a7ed76d8c595024a709e09
spent
true